안드로이드 스튜디오에서 자바 언어를 선택하는 방법



안드로이드 스튜디오에서 자바 언어를 선택하는 방법

안드로이드 앱 개발을 위한 새로운 프로젝트를 시작할 때 언어 선택의 어려움이 종종 발생할 수 있다. 특히 자바 언어로 프로젝트를 생성하려는 경우, 특정 조건에 따라 언어 선택 화면이 나타나지 않을 수 있다. 이러한 문제를 해결하기 위해서는 선택하는 활동 유형에 주의해야 한다.

 

👉 ✅ 상세 정보 바로 확인 👈

 

Empty Activity vs. Empty Views Activity의 차이

안드로이드 스튜디오에서 새 프로젝트를 생성할 때, Empty Activity를 선택하는 경우 언어 선택 화면이 보이지 않는다. 이는 많은 개발자들이 처음에 겪는 혼란 중 하나이다. Empty Activity는 기본적인 화면을 제공하지만, 언어 선택 옵션을 포함하지 않는다.



반면, Empty Views Activity를 선택하면 Java 또는 Kotlin 언어를 선택할 수 있는 화면이 등장한다. 이 두 가지 선택의 차이는 종종 간과되기 때문에, 프로젝트를 시작하기 전 이 점을 반드시 확인해야 한다.

Empty Activity 선택 시의 문제점

Empty Activity를 선택하고 새 프로젝트를 생성하면, 언어 선택 화면이 제공되지 않기 때문에 자바나 코틀린 중 어떤 언어를 사용할지 결정할 수 없다. 이로 인해 많은 개발자들이 자바 언어로 작업하고자 할 때 혼란을 겪게 된다.

이런 상황에서 필요한 것은 단순히 선택하는 활동 유형을 바꾸는 것이다. Empty Views Activity를 선택함으로써 언어 옵션이 나타나게 되어, 개발자는 원하는 언어를 선택할 수 있다. 이러한 흐름은 많은 이들이 놓치는 부분이므로, 주의 깊게 확인해야 한다.

Empty Views Activity 선택의 장점

Empty Views Activity를 선택하면 언어 선택 외에도 다양한 기본 요소를 포함한 템플릿이 제공된다. 이는 프로젝트의 초기 설정을 보다 쉽게 진행할 수 있게 해준다. 언어를 선택한 후, 원하는 기능을 추가하는 과정이 순조롭게 이어질 수 있다.

이러한 장점은 개발자들이 초기 단계에서부터 적절한 선택을 하도록 유도하며, 나중에 발생할 수 있는 불필요한 문제를 예방할 수 있다. 따라서 새로운 프로젝트를 시작할 때는 반드시 Empty Views Activity를 검토하는 것이 좋다.

 

👉 ✅ 상세 정보 바로 확인 👈

 

언어 선택 화면의 이해

언어 선택 화면은 보통 프로젝트를 생성할 때 가장 먼저 접하게 되는 단계 중 하나이다. 이 화면에서 자바와 코틀린 중 하나를 선택할 수 있으며, 이는 프로젝트의 주요 언어로 설정된다.

자바 언어의 장점

자바는 안드로이드 개발의 전통적인 언어로, 널리 사용되고 있다. 많은 라이브러리와 프레임워크가 자바로 작성되어 있어, 개발 시 유용하게 활용할 수 있다. 또한, 자바는 안정성과 성능이 뛰어난 언어로 알려져 있어, 중대형 프로젝트에도 적합하다.

코틀린의 부상

코틀린은 최근 안드로이드 개발에서 인기를 끌고 있는 언어로, 자바와의 호환성이 높다. 코틀린은 간결한 문법과 현대적인 기능을 제공하여, 코드의 가독성과 유지보수성을 증대시킨다. 많은 신규 프로젝트가 코틀린을 기본 언어로 선택하는 추세이다.

프로젝트 생성 시 유의할 점

안드로이드 스튜디오에서 프로젝트를 생성할 때 유의해야 할 몇 가지 사항이 있다. 언어 선택 외에도 다양한 설정이 필요하다.

필수 설정 체크리스트

  1. 프로젝트 이름과 패키지 이름 결정
  2. 타겟 SDK 버전 설정
  3. 앱의 최소 SDK 버전 선택
  4. 기본 활동 유형 선택 (Empty Views Activity 추천)
  5. 언어 선택 (Java 또는 Kotlin)

이러한 설정들은 프로젝트의 초기 구조와 기능에 큰 영향을 미친다. 따라서 각 항목을 신중하게 선택하는 것이 중요하다.

프로젝트 생성을 위한 전반적인 진행

새로운 안드로이드 프로젝트를 생성하는 과정은 다음과 같은 흐름으로 진행된다.

프로젝트 생성 단계

  1. 안드로이드 스튜디오 실행
  2. New Project 클릭
  3. Empty Views Activity 선택
  4. 언어 옵션에서 Java 선택
  5. 필요한 설정 입력 후 Finish 클릭

이러한 단계들을 통해, 개발자는 원활하게 안드로이드 프로젝트를 시작할 수 있다. 실수로 잘못된 옵션을 선택하지 않도록 주의가 필요하다.

🤔 진짜 궁금한 것들 (FAQ)

  1. Empty Activity와 Empty Views Activity의 차이는 무엇인가요?
    Empty Activity는 언어 선택 옵션이 없고 기본 화면만 제공하며, Empty Views Activity는 언어 선택이 가능한 템플릿을 제공합니다.

  2. 자바와 코틀린 중 어느 언어를 선택해야 할까요?
    프로젝트의 성격에 따라 다르지만, 자바는 안정성과 성능이 뛰어나고, 코틀린은 현대적인 기능을 제공합니다.

  3. 안드로이드 스튜디오에서 언어 선택이 보이지 않으면 어떻게 해야 하나요?
    Empty Views Activity를 선택하면 언어 선택 화면이 나타나므로, 해당 옵션으로 변경해야 합니다.

  4. 프로젝트 생성 시 필수적으로 설정해야 할 항목은 무엇인가요?
    프로젝트 이름, 패키지 이름, 타겟 SDK 버전, 최소 SDK 버전, 활동 유형, 언어 선택 등이 포함됩니다.

  5. 자바와 코틀린의 장단점은 무엇인가요?
    자바는 널리 사용되고 안정적이며, 코틀린은 간결한 문법과 기능을 제공하여 유지보수성이 높습니다.

  6. 안드로이드 스튜디오에서 초기 설정을 잘못하면 어떻게 되나요?
    초기 설정이 잘못될 경우, 프로젝트에 문제가 발생할 수 있으므로 초기 단계에서 신중하게 설정해야 합니다.

  7. Empty Views Activity를 선택하는 이유는 무엇인가요?
    언어 선택이 가능하고 다양한 기본 요소를 제공하여, 프로젝트 시작을 보다 쉽게 할 수 있습니다.